SDNU 1430.十六进制转八进制(python)
生活随笔
收集整理的這篇文章主要介紹了
SDNU 1430.十六进制转八进制(python)
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
Description
問題描述 給定n個十六進制正整數,輸出它們對應的八進制數。 輸入格式 輸入的第一行為一個正整數n? (1< =n< =10)。 接下來n行,每行一個由0~9、大寫字母A~F組成的字符串,表示要轉換的十六進制正整數,每個十六進制數長度不超過100000。 輸出格式 輸出n行,每行為輸入對應的八進制正整數。 注意 輸入的十六進制數不會有前導0,比如012A。 輸出的八進制數也不能有前導0。 樣例輸入 2 39 123ABC 樣例輸出 71 4435274 提示 先將十六進制數轉換成某進制數,再由某進制數轉換成八進制。Input
Output
Sample Input
Sample Output
Source
Unknown t = int(input()) for i in range(t):n = input()ans = oct(int(n, 16))print(ans[2:])?
轉載于:https://www.cnblogs.com/RootVount/p/11559948.html
總結
以上是生活随笔為你收集整理的SDNU 1430.十六进制转八进制(python)的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: SDNU 1085.爬楼梯再加强版(矩阵
- 下一篇: 计算机领域中随处可见的抽象